Solution for What is 4440 increased by 36 percent? (4440 plus 36%):

4440 + (36/100 * 4440) = 6038.4

Now we have: 4440 increased by 36 percent = 6038.4

Question: What is 4440 increased by 36 percent?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: We have a with value of 4440.

Step 2: We have b with value of 36.

Step 3: The formula for calculation will be: a + (b/100 * a) = x.

Step 4: We could also represent this as: x = a + (\frac{b}{100} * a).

Step 5: We now replace with the values: x = 4440 + (\frac{36}{100} * 4440).

Step 6: That gives us an {x} = {6038.4}

Therefore, {4440} increased by {36\%} is {6038.4}
